What Causes Bloody Vaginal Drainage In Post Menopausal Stage?

I am post menopausal and had a few spots of bloody vaginal drainage about 6 months ago. Went to my Gyn and had an endometrial bx and ultrasound- both neg. last night, had one drop of blood on a tissue after sex with my husband. Should I be seen again?

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hi,
Kindly visit a gynaecologist and get a PAP smear done (tissue from cervix is examined under microsope).

Dont worry sometimes during menopause little bit of vaginal bleeding is seen until it completely stops.However right now getting a pap smear done is important.
